Ticket: Password reset revamp — intermittent token expiry mismatch. After the Lumette flow rework shipped, users on the Driftbay cluster report reset links expiring immediately. We suspect the new clock-skew guard in the Veylan auth service rejects tokens minted by the old path. Please verify both paths against staging before rollback. The affected build is identified by the token below.

session token of kageg-tahop = htk14_af3c1ccccb7dcf

## Runbook — Account Recovery: Ovenwick Order-Cutoff Service

Security reviewer notes: the Ovenwick bakery platform enforces a hard order-cutoff at close of the evening batch window, and the admin account controlling that rule occasionally locks after config drift. Recovery requires verifying the requester against the on-file approver list, confirming no cutoff changes occurred in the last 24 hours, and logging the session. Restore admin access with the recovery passphrase below.

vault phrase of bagaf-kajeg = jorath-feniel-briir-siliel-ralix

Meeting notes — ledger archiving. Agreed: 2019–2021 paper ledgers from the Brindall office go to the Covemoor storage facility next Tuesday. Boxes sealed and labelled by Friday. One van, single run, morning slot. Driver to be briefed by the coordinator beforehand. The following instruction must be passed to the driver verbatim.

handover note for tafog-bawef: the ulair kasael courier leaves the ralok gilmir fenael druwyn feneth queniel belix keliel ledger at gate 5216 under passcode 961436

Prepared for the board of Quellanda Foods. Effective next quarter, fulfilment transfers from Harwick Freight to Dovelane Logistics. Transition costs are estimated at a one-time charge absorbed within the current budget, offset by projected annual savings of roughly 12% on distribution. Service-level terms improve delivery windows in the northern regions. Contract length is three years with an exit clause after eighteen months. Finance considers the risk profile acceptable. A confidential note on business plans follows immediately below.

board note of bajop-yaweg: The western region missed its Pelys quota by 58.0 percent last quarter. Pelysek Foods plans to raise the Belius list price by 44.0 percent in July. The steering committee signed off on a budget of $133.8 million for Project Pelax. The renewal with Zoraelix Systems closes at $61.9 million a year, 12.7 percent above the last contract.